Over the past few months, the National Consensus Commission has worked on recommendations for reforms in various sectors to ensure good governance, democracy, and social justice, and to prevent the recurrence of authoritarian rule. For this purpose, six sub-commissions were formed to provide recommendations on reforms in the constitution, electoral system, judiciary, public administration, police, and anti-corruption measures.
The National Consensus Commission created the July National Charter after discussions with 30 parties and alliances. It included 84 proposals, of which 25 parties and alliances have already signed and committed to implementing the reforms.
During the handover, the commission members stated that establishing consensus for reform is now extremely urgent to strengthen the country’s democratic institutions and ensure good governance.
